    had some rain tonight and when i did a turn a pile of water came out form behind the stereo part of the dash onto my foot. am hopin its not rust related. am hopin its only a block drain. any help be appreciated.

    thought id add this when i use the air con to there is no water where i park. sometimes when i start car up i can hear water sloshing around.

    I had a problem a few weeks ago, I had water comming in from the antenna lead from the radio, the gromet and lead were faulty..BUT this was filling up the LH foot well.
    Its pos that the AC drain hose has come off or blocked going through the firewall.
